In a major earthquake, prioritize "Drop, Cover, Hold On." If in a coastal area during a tsunami warning, move to higher ground immediately.
Confirm your passport remains valid for good for at least six months past your Japan stay.
Secure your flights to Tokyo Haneda (HND) or Narita (NRT).
Book your main hotels, especially during peak seasons when properties fill quickly.
Map out your daily pursuits, including attractions, dining, plus outings.
Pre-order a pocket Wi-Fi rental for airport pickup or purchase a tourist SIM card.
Inform your bank and credit card companies of your travel dates.
International flights, accommodation, Japan Rail Pass (when suitable), along with certain common tours or workshops (e.g., CupNoodles Museum Chicken Ramen Factory) pre-booking is necessary.
